Trump Eases Tensions with Iran, Oil Prices Plummet as US Stock Futures Rise

US stock futures rose in pre-market trading on August 3 as tensions between the US and Iran eased. Following President Trump's announcement that military action against Iran was suspended, oil prices plummeted below $80 per barrel.

The Dow futures jumped 1.02%, while S&P 500 futures rose 0.65% and Nasdaq 100 futures increased by 0.35%. Oil prices fell sharply, with WTI crude dropping over 8% to around $79.5 and Brent crude trading at $83.5.

AWS revenue grew 37% year-over-year to $42.2 billion in Amazon's recent earnings report, validating AI cloud demand and driving a recovery in sentiment for mega-cap tech stocks.
